What Is UTV Clutching?
In simplest terms, clutching in a UTV (Utility Task Vehicle) refers to the system that connects the engine to the wheels, controlling how power is transmitted and how the vehicle accelerates. The clutch system allows for smooth transitions between gears, helping to transfer the power from the engine to the drivetrain, and ensuring the vehicle runs smoothly under various conditions.
The two main components of the clutch system are:
- Drive Clutch: Connected to the engine, it controls the acceleration and transfers power to the belt.
- Driven Clutch: Connected to the gearbox, it works with the drive clutch to regulate how the power is sent to the wheels.
Together, these components allow the UTV to automatically adjust to changes in throttle input, load, and terrain.
How Does UTV Clutching Work?
The basic mechanism of a UTV clutch system revolves around a variable-pulley system, which is typically belt-driven. Here’s a simple explanation of how it works:
-
Drive Clutch Engagement: When you push the throttle, the drive clutch begins to engage. The clutch starts to spin, and as the speed increases, the clutch sheaves move closer together, increasing the belt tension. This action begins transferring power from the engine to the drive belt, ultimately driving the UTV’s wheels.
-
Driven Clutch Interaction: As the engine RPM (revolutions per minute) rises, the driven clutch adjusts. It’s connected to the transmission, and as the drive clutch increases tension on the belt, the driven clutch will push the belt to a higher gear ratio. This enables the UTV to accelerate and shift efficiently.
-
Centrifugal Force: The clutch operates using centrifugal force to automatically adjust the pressure and engagement point. This allows the UTV to adapt to different terrains and loads without the need for manual gear shifting.
How to Improve UTV Clutching Performance
Improving your UTV’s clutching performance can have a massive impact on your ride’s overall responsiveness and efficiency. Here are some ways to improve your clutching:
-
Clutch Kits: Custom clutch kits are one of the best ways to tune your UTV. These kits typically come with new springs, weights, and a clutch assembly designed for specific riding conditions (such as higher elevation, sand dunes, or mud). They ensure that the clutch system is properly tuned to handle the specific demands of your ride.
-
Upgraded Springs and Weights: The springs control the engagement and the weights help to adjust the RPM at which the clutch engages. By selecting the right weight and spring combination, you can fine-tune how the clutch responds to throttle input, optimizing performance for acceleration, top speed, or load-bearing.
-
Clutch Tuning and Maintenance: Regular maintenance is key to keeping your clutch system working at peak performance. Cleaning the clutches, inspecting the drive belt, and adjusting components like the weights and springs will ensure that the system works as intended. A well-maintained clutch offers better responsiveness and longevity.
-
Aftermarket Belts: Upgrading to a higher-performance belt can increase clutch efficiency. Higher quality belts handle heat better, provide smoother engagement, and last longer. This ensures better power transfer and prevents slippage or belt failure.
-
Shoe and Drum Replacements: If your clutch shoes or drums are worn out, it can result in poor engagement and loss of power. Replacing them with higher-grade components can increase the overall lifespan and performance of your clutch system.
